What is Voltage Protection for LED TVs?

When we talk about voltage protection for LED TVs, we refer to the use of stabilizers or voltage regulators that prevent damage to your TV from power surges, spikes, or dips. These voltage fluctuations can occur unexpectedly and wreak havoc on your TV's delicate internal components.

LED TVs are particularly sensitive to changes in voltage, which is why it’s essential to have a stabilizer that ensures a steady power supply. If you’re wondering, is stabilizer required for LED TV, the answer lies in the fact that without such protection, your TV could experience issues like erratic performance or even permanent damage from electrical surges. A stabilizer acts as a buffer, preventing such damage by regulating the power your TV receives.

Risks of No Stabilizer for LED TVs

One of the most pressing concerns regarding is stabilizer required for LED TV is the risks of not using one. Without a stabilizer, your LED TV is at the mercy of voltage fluctuations, which can lead to several issues:

  • Shortened lifespan: Repeated exposure to voltage surges can degrade your TV’s internal components, leading to reduced lifespan.
  • Internal component damage: Power surges, particularly during thunderstorms or power grid fluctuations, can cause immediate damage to the power supply unit and other critical components.
  • Sudden shutdowns and flickering screens: A common sign that your TV is not receiving stable voltage is frequent shutdowns or flickering on the screen, which can be both frustrating and damaging.

The risks of no stabilizer are severe and can lead to costly repairs. For these reasons, it’s crucial to protect your LED TV with a stabilizer.

Recommended Stabilizer Types for LED TVs

To answer the question, is stabilizer required for LED TV, it’s also important to know which types of stabilizers work best for your TV. Here are some recommended stabilizer types based on your TV's size and power requirements:

  • 1-amp stabilizer: Suitable for TVs up to 55 inches. This stabilizer is designed for smaller TVs and provides sufficient protection for everyday usage.
  • 2-amp stabilizer: Ideal for larger TVs, particularly those above 55 inches, which require more robust voltage regulation.
  • Digital stabilizers: These advanced stabilizers come with a digital display, showing real-time voltage readings and alerts. They offer superior protection for sensitive LED TVs.

The correct stabilizer type ensures that your LED TV receives the protection it needs to last longer and perform better.

Understanding Voltage Fluctuations and Their Impact on TVs

Voltage fluctuations and TVs are a dangerous combination. Fluctuations occur when the power supply changes unexpectedly, either rising above or dropping below the normal operating level. These irregularities can be caused by issues like faulty wiring, grid problems, or power surges from appliances starting up.

Without a stabilizer, these fluctuations can cause significant damage to your LED TV. For example, power surges can burn out internal circuits, while voltage drops can cause the TV to flicker or shut down completely.

To protect your LED TV, it's essential to invest in proper voltage protection for LED TVs to keep your device safe from these harmful fluctuations.

Appliance Protection Tips Beyond Stabilizers

While stabilizers are essential, there are also other appliance protection tips to safeguard your electronics:

  • Surge protectors: Use a surge protector along with your stabilizer for added protection against sudden power spikes.
  • Electrical maintenance: Regularly inspect your home’s wiring and electrical system to ensure everything is functioning properly.
  • Avoid overloads: Never overload a single outlet by plugging in too many devices. This can cause a strain on the circuit and increase the risk of damage.

These appliance protection tips can help you keep your LED TV and other devices safe from electrical damage.
